发电机进相试验引起失磁保护动作分析

摘    要:介绍了一起发电机进相试验引起失磁保护动作的事件,由此分析比较了发电机失磁保护采用不同的阻抗圆定值对发电机进相深度的限制情况,提出用发电机励磁低励限制曲线整定来防止发电机失磁保护由于发电机进相误动作的方法。

关 键 词:发电机  进相  失磁保护  低励限制

Abstract:Error acting of excitation loss protection during generator leading phase testing is introduced. This thesis anaIyzed and compared different impedance circle constant values adopted by generator loss of excitation protection with corresponding limiting cases of genetator leading phase depth. It is put forward a method by using generator low excitation limit curve to prevent generator loss of excitation protection caused by genetator leading phase misoperation.
